Ray White’s Leadership Academy zooms in 2020 style
Ray White on Wednesday hosted its sixth Leadership Academy over Zoom for its corporate team with world-renowned Harvard Business School Professor Boris Groysberg.
Ray White Managing Director Dan White said the Leadership Academy was one of the most important events on Ray White Group’s calendar.
“We were not going to let the COVID-19 pandemic stop us from hosting our sixth academy. We have a key duty to our corporate team and business owners to keep improving and keep striving for innovation and we remain restless to better ourselves,” Mr White said.
Prof Groysberg said Ray White as a case study itself was in a rarefied category.
“There’s only a very few handful of family owned businesses in the world still growing under fourth generation leadership and I am excited to share the Ray White case study with other business leaders from around the world.”
The 118 year old property group recorded $44.22 billion in sales across its network of 1000 offices in 2019-20, up 8.6 per cent year on year. Its product offerings and technological capabilities keep evolving to help its franchisees thrive and become more productive.
The property group has experienced a high rate of growth in terms of market share across its Australian and New Zealand networks despite the COVID-19 pandemic of 2020.
